Miss K Berkeley v Clarity Products Ltd: 3204951/2021

EMPLOYMENT TRIBUNALS
Case No 3204951/2021
Miss K BerkeleyClaimantClarity Products LtdRespondent
Employment Judge TaylorDate 30 November 2021

JUDGMENT

Employment Tribunals Rules of Procedure 2013 – Rule 21[1]The claim was issued in the London East Employment Tribunals on 7 th July 2021. The respondent has failed to present a valid response on time. The Employment Judge has decided that a determination can properly be made of the claim, or part of it, in accordance with rule 21 of the Rules of Procedure.[2]The respondent has made unauthorised deductions from the claimant’s wages and must pay the claimant £1395.02 gross.[3]The claimant was dismissed by reason of redundancy and is entitled to a redundancy payment of £627.84.[4]The respondent has failed to pay the claimant’s holiday entitlement and must pay the claimant £91.44.[5]The respondent must pay the claimant £2114.28 in total.[6]The hearing listed on 17th December 2021 is cancelled.
